After installing and moving my Amahi server to a new building I noticed the outside IP was incorrect. I ended up following the FAQ advice (Below) and deleting the profile on amahi.org and creating a new one. When I run hda-new-install it cannot find the file. I am logged in a root and I know Linux fairly well. Any advice? I'm about ready to wipe the server and start fresh...

Create a new profile in your control panel with the same settings, but with the new domain. This will give you a new install code.
In your HDA, bring up a terminal with root access (or ssh into your HDA if you do not have console).
Remove a file with this: rm /etc/sysconfig/amahi-hda
Run this command: hda-new-install -f NEWINSTALLCODE (replacing the NEWINSTALLCODE with your new install code you obtained above)

For Amahi 7 hda-install is in /usr/bin directory. You may have to execute it from there.

If it were me and you have not changed/added much, I would just do a fresh install. It may take a lot longer to sort this out manually. Doing a second install may just make things worse.
